VEON Partners with Hala to Expand Ride-Hailing Services Across Central Asia and South Asia

VEON Ltd. has entered into a Memorandum of Understanding with Hala, Dubai's prominent e-hailing platform, to evaluate potential cooperation in developing ride-hailing and mobility services. The partnership would extend Hala's operational capabilities across VEON's five key markets: Pakistan, Ukraine, Kazakhstan, Uzbekistan, and Bangladesh, creating an integrated approach to regional mobility solutions.

The strategic exploration aims to combine Hala's established transportation expertise with VEON's extensive digital infrastructure and subscriber base. By leveraging VEON's presence as a major telecommunications provider in emerging markets, the partnership would seek to develop region-specific ride-hailing platforms tailored to local market conditions and consumer preferences.

The cooperation represents VEON's continued diversification into digital services beyond traditional telecom operations. Through integration with VEON's broader digital ecosystem, the ride-hailing services would be positioned to cross-promote with existing fintech, entertainment, and e-commerce offerings, potentially creating enhanced value propositions for users across the targeted markets.
